Ernest (4186), Boulder, Colorado, USA Jan 23, 2008 Bottle (thanks Jonas!), Munich (BB Apr 07).
Head is initially small, frothy, light brown, mostly diminishing.
Body is dark brown.
Aroma is moderately malty (caramel, toasted bread, nuts), lightly hoppy (flowers, herbs), with notes of plum and overripe banana.
Flavor is moderately to heavily sweet, lightly bitter.
Finish is lightly to moderately sweet, lightly to moderately bitter.
Medium to full body, velvety/syrupy texture, lively carbonation, lightly alcoholic.
Despite being many months past the BB date, this was still in remarkably good condition and didn’t show much if any evidence of its age. Not a strong contender, but a solid enough example. henrikb (1008), Aarhus, Denmark Jan 22, 2008 Bottle - Deep chestnut body with a beige head; Soft warm nose, malty complex but not really existing, lacks cogency; Small but sharp carbonation and malty full in body doesnt fit to well in a body that is a bit lose; Long malty sugary sweet finish, somehow a bit to simple vulgar texture on a watery body, not to balanced and not well composed, but drinkable.
